Complete the following chemicals equation
`CH_(3)CH_(2)CH=CH_(2)+HBr overset(("peroxide"))to`

Text Solution

AI Generated Solution

To complete the chemical equation for the reaction of 1-butene (CH₃CH₂CH=CH₂) with HBr in the presence of peroxide, we will follow these steps: ### Step-by-Step Solution: 1. **Identify the Reactants**: The reactants are 1-butene (CH₃CH₂CH=CH₂) and HBr, with the presence of peroxide. 2. **Understand the Reaction Type**: This is an addition reaction where HBr adds across the double bond of the alkene. ...
